Description

The GE IS200EGDMH1ADE is a high-performance Exciter Ground Detector Module designed for the EX2100 Excitation Control System. It monitors both DC and AC ground faults in the generator field, preventing equipment damage and enhancing overall system safety.

Equipped with 12 input channels and supporting 4–20 mA analog input spans, this module delivers precise fault detection and insulation monitoring. It is designed with surface-mount technology and mounted on a DIN rail within the Exciter Power Backplane (EPBP), allowing efficient integration into industrial excitation systems.

Its conformal-coated PCB ensures reliability and durability in harsh industrial environments, including exposure to moisture, dust, and temperature fluctuations. The compact design and robust construction make it ideal for continuous operation in critical generator applications.

Technical Specifications

Model Number: IS200EGDMH1ADE
Manufacturer: General Electric (GE)
Series: EX2100 Excitation Control System
Product Type: Exciter Ground Detector Module
Number of Channels: 12
Input Span: 4–20 mA
Analog Output Current: 0–20 mA
Common Mode Voltage Range: ±5 V
Maximum Lead Resistance: 15 Ω
Technology: Surface-mount
Mounting Type: DIN rail within EPBP rack
Operating Temperature: –30°C to +65°C
Dimensions: 8.26 cm × 4.19 cm
Weight:350 g
